Почему важно защищать htaccess файл от несанкционированного доступа

CMS.BY

Лучшие практики защиты htaccess файла: почему это важно

В мире веб-разработки и администрирования серверов безопасность htaccess файла стоит на первом месте. Этот небольшой, но мощный конфигурационный файл может стать уязвимой точкой для хакеров, если его не защитить должным образом.

Что такое htaccess файл и зачем он нужен

Файл .htaccess — это конфигурационный файл в веб-серверах Apache, который позволяет настраивать различные параметры работы сервера на уровне директорий. Он используется для настройки перенаправлений, аутентификации пользователей, ограничения доступа и многих других функций.

Почему htaccess файл может быть уязвимым

Из-за своей гибкости и мощности htaccess файл может стать лёгкой мишенью для злоумышленников. Если файл не защищён, хакеры могут внести в него изменения, которые позволят им получить доступ к вашему сайту или даже к серверу.

Как защитить htaccess файл от несанкционированного доступа

Существует несколько способов защиты htaccess файла:

  • Ограничение доступа через файрвол или настройки сервера.
  • Использование strong паролей и аутентификации.
  • Регулярное резервное копирование файла.
  • Мониторинг изменений файла.

Пример настройки ограничения доступа

Чтобы ограничить доступ к htaccess файлу, можно использовать следующие настройки в файле .htaccess:


<Files .htaccess>
    Order allow,deny
    Deny from all
</Files>

Реальные кейсы и мини-истории

Рассмотрим пример, когда недостаточная защита htaccess файла привела к серьёзным последствиям. В 2019 году один из крупных сайтов столкнулся с проблемой, когда злоумышленники получили доступ к htaccess файлу и внесли в него изменения, позволяющие им перенаправлять пользователей на фишинговые сайты. Это привело к потере доверия пользователей и значительным финансовым потерям.

Чек-лист по защите htaccess файла

Вот несколько шагов, которые помогут вам защитить htaccess файл:

  1. Проверьте настройки сервера и файрвола.
  2. Используйте strong пароли и аутентификацию.
  3. Регулярно делайте резервные копии файла.
  4. Следите за изменениями файла.
  5. Ограничьте доступ к файлу через настройки сервера.

Итоги

Защита htaccess файла от несанкционированного доступа — это важная часть обеспечения безопасности вашего сайта. Вот несколько ключевых моментов:

  • Htaccess файл — это мощный инструмент, который может стать уязвимой точкой для хакеров.
  • Существует несколько способов защиты htaccess файла, включая ограничение доступа, использование strong паролей и аутентификации, регулярное резервное копирование и мониторинг изменений.
  • Недостаточная защита htaccess файла может привести к серьёзным последствиям, таким как потеря доверия пользователей и финансовые потери.
  • Следуя чек-листу по защите htaccess файла, вы сможете значительно повысить безопасность вашего сайта.

Помните, что безопасность — это не одноразовая задача, а непрерывный процесс. Регулярно проверяйте настройки безопасности вашего сайта и обновляйте их в соответствии с лучшими практиками.

Редакция CMS.BY

Редакция CMS.BY

С нами Мир познавать проще и надёжнее

shape

У Вас остались вопросы? Обязательно обратитесь к нам
Мы проконсультируем Вас по любому вопросу в сфере IT

Оставить заявку